Output 10343358fac8a4f74df9238f68ac86effd30db74cb4940d30ccbaadb129e8932:0

value
98514420
script pubkey
OP_0 OP_PUSHBYTES_20 824f455141313f95a5451fa4a655aa449a574809
address
ltc1qsf85252pxyletf29r7j2v4d2gjd9wjqfw970lx
transaction
10343358fac8a4f74df9238f68ac86effd30db74cb4940d30ccbaadb129e8932
spent
true